Signs You Need Help from a Commercial Landscaping Maintenance Service

Blog

Maintaining a commercial property's landscape can be a daunting task, and neglecting it can lead to unsightly and unwelcoming spaces. Outsourcing this work to a professional commercial landscaping maintenance service ensures your property remains attractive and functional. Here are some signs that it might be time to call in the experts.

Overgrown and Unruly Plants

When trees, shrubs, and flower beds are neglected, they can quickly grow out of control, creating a chaotic and unkempt appearance. This not only affects the aesthetic appeal of your property but can also become a safety hazard. A professional service can provide regular trimming, pruning, and maintenance to keep your plants in check and your landscape looking its best.

Patchy or Dead Grass

A lush, green lawn is often the centerpiece of a well-maintained landscape. If you notice areas of patchy or dead grass, it's a clear indication that your lawn is suffering from neglect or improper care. A commercial landscaping maintenance service has the expertise to diagnose the problem and implement solutions such as aeration, proper fertilization, and pest control to revive your lawn.

Accumulation of Weeds

Weeds are the bane of any landscape, and their presence can quickly diminish the overall appearance of your property. If you find yourself constantly battling an accumulation of weeds, it's a sign that your landscape needs professional help. A commercial landscaping service can provide effective weed management strategies, including regular removal and the application of pre-emergent herbicides to prevent future growth.

Inadequate Irrigation

Proper irrigation is essential for maintaining a healthy and vibrant landscape. If you notice that your plants are wilting, your grass is turning brown, or there are areas of standing water, it indicates a problem with your irrigation system. Poor irrigation can lead to water wastage, soil erosion, and plant stress. A commercial landscaping maintenance service can assess your current irrigation setup, make necessary repairs, and design a more efficient system to ensure your landscape gets the right amount of water.

Seasonal Transitions

Different seasons bring different challenges for landscape maintenance. If your property looks neglected during seasonal transitions, such as the transition from winter to spring or summer to fall, it's a sign that you need professional help. Each season requires specific care to prepare your landscape for the changing weather conditions. For instance, a commercial landscaping service can perform fall clean-ups, winterize your irrigation system, plant seasonal flowers, and ensure your landscape remains appealing and functional year-round.

Maintaining a commercial landscape requires consistent and knowledgeable care. Professional landscapers have the skills, tools, and experience to keep your property looking impressive and inviting, ultimately enhancing the overall value and appeal of your commercial space.
